12578921
0xd59d45012b78bb4f34ccce240aecc26ae11bf3a8099e16a5aeb68d2e58a25d2f
Transactions0
Height12578921
Confirmations9211790
Timestamp1416 days 14 hours ago
Size (bytes)536
Version
Merkle Root
Nonce0x59f26cf261bd9224
Bits
Difficulty0xa2408b8e5ade